About VAM

The Virtual Artisan Market (VAM) was born from a collaboration with Saving Orphans through Healthcare and Outreach (SOHO) to support vulnerable children in Eswatini. Developed by Andrews University’s School of Business Administration, VAM connects artisans from low-income communities with global buyers. Offering unique handcrafted products and empowering artisans with education and skills.
Bridging Artisanship and Impact

The inception of VAM began through collaboration with the Indianapolis-based nonprofit SOHO in late 2022. SOHO’s mission is to aid vulnerable children affected by AIDS/HIV in Eswatini, seeking sustainable solutions for their safety, education, and health.

The School of Business Administration at Andrews University embraced this challenge. Various classes within the school united their efforts to create a sustainable business model. This model would support SOHO’s initiatives and communities. Consequently, their collaboration culminated in the creation of the Virtual Artisan Marketplace Project.

Our Mission

VAM’s mission is to create a global platform that connects artisan groups from lower-income communities with the global market. By showcasing and selling their unique, handcrafted products, VAM aims to provide artisans with sustainable income opportunities. While also offering buyers around the world access to unique goods with rich cultural heritage. Beyond commerce, VAM is committed to empowering these communities through literacy, business education, and life skills training. Addressing the root causes of poverty and creating lasting change.
